Drew Stanton Autographs
Drew Stanton is a former American football quarterback who played in the National Football League (NFL) for 12 seasons. He was born on May 7, 1984, in Okemos, Michigan, and started his football career at Michigan State University. During his time at MSU, he was a three-year starter and led his team to a Big Ten Conference Championship in 2004. Stanton was drafted by the Detroit Lions in the second round of the 2007 NFL Draft and spent four seasons with the team before moving on to play for other teams.
Stanton's most successful season in the NFL came in 2014 when he played for the Arizona Cardinals. In this season, he played in eight games, starting three of them, and threw for 1094 yards and seven touchdowns. The Cardinals went 11-5 that season, and Stanton played a crucial role in helping his team reach the playoffs. Throughout his career, Drew Stanton played for five different teams in the NFL, including the Lions, the New York Jets, the Indianapolis Colts, the Arizona Cardinals, and the Cleveland Browns.
In May of 2021, Stanton announced his retirement from the NFL after playing for 12 seasons. He was widely respected by his teammates and coaches for his leadership, work ethic, and dedication to the game. Following his retirement, he plans to continue his involvement with football through coaching and mentoring young players. Drew Stanton's successful career in the NFL has left a lasting legacy and serves as an inspiration to many young athletes who aspire to achieve success at the highest level of football.
